
Only a few games remain until postseason college basketball. Who’s the favorite for the SEC title?
Only three games remain in the regular season. And what a season it’s been.
I’m not just talking about Missouri either. Anyone with a pulse on college basketball is aware of the historic nature of the Southeastern Conference’s depth this season. As of Friday afternoon, ESPN Bracketology had 13 teams out of the SEC’s 16 in the field of 68. That’s two more than the current record of 11 teams sent by the Big East in 2011… and that still might be selling the SEC short.
Only two teams — South Carolina and LSU — are unofficially out of the race, assuming of course they don’t run the table at the SEC Tournament. Teams like Arkansas, Oklahoma, Texas and Georgia are all fighting for some of the final remaining bids, and the quality of the conference means they’ll all have plenty of chances to stack impressive wins before Selection Sunday.
Even with the staggering depth of the conference, however, we’ve come to the point in the season where the race for the regular season title has become top-heavy. In fact, the title could be sewn up this weekend. Auburn currently leads the pack at 14-1, with only 12-3 Alabama and 11-4 Florida able to mathematically catch them. Yeah, no surprise there! It’s looking all but sewn up that Auburn is going to capture its third regular season SEC title under Bruce Pearl. Florida would need the Tigers to lose out to give themselves the tie-breaker. Even in that scenario, Florida would need to beat Alabama in Tuscaloosa next week, which seems far-fetched (though not impossible.) Alabama needs some serious slippage from Auburn in the coming weeks, but could have all to play for in the final game of the regular season next weekend, when they head to Neville Arena.
